Shark Diversifications for Feeding
Sharks are apex predators within the marine ecosystem, famend for his or her outstanding searching prowess. Their good fortune as predators may also be attributed to a set of specialised anatomical and physiological diversifications that improve their skill to come across, seize, and eat prey.
Sensory Diversifications
Sharks possess an array of sensory organs that permit them to find and observe prey in numerous aquatic environments. Those come with:
Ampullae of Lorenzini
Electroreceptors situated close to the snout, touchy to minute electric fields emitted by way of prey, offering a “6th sense” for detecting hidden prey.
Lateral line gadget
A community of pressure-sensitive cells operating alongside the frame, detecting water vibrations and strain adjustments led to by way of prey motion.
Olfactory organs
Prepared sense of scent, in a position to detecting minute concentrations of chemical substances launched by way of prey.
Imaginative and prescient
Some shark species have very good imaginative and prescient, with diversifications for low-light stipulations and intensity belief.
Tooth and Jaws
Shark enamel are specialised for gripping and tearing flesh. They’re organized in more than one rows, with new enamel continuously changing misplaced or broken ones. The form and measurement of shark enamel range relying on their feeding behavior, with some species possessing serrated enamel for reducing thru tricky prey.The
shark’s jaw is an impressive construction, with sturdy muscle tissue and a novel articulation that permits for vast gape angles. This permits sharks to engulf massive prey entire or take large bites.
Digestive Device
Sharks have a powerful digestive gadget designed to procedure massive quantities of meals. Their stomachs are extremely acidic, in a position to breaking down prey briefly and successfully. The spiral valve, a specialised intestinal construction, will increase the outside space for nutrient absorption, maximizing power extraction from meals.
